Before washing, turn your tie dye garments inside out to protect the colors. Run the washer on the gentle cycle using cold water. Avoid leaving the garments in the wash too long after the cycle finishes, so the colors don’t bleed! Air dry if possible. If not, dry in the dryer on a medium or low heat setting. After first rinsing the dye from your garment, try soaking your tie dye for 30 minutes in a solution of equal parts white vinegar and cold water. Vinegar aids in maintaining colorfastness. Add multiple colors or stick to just one.Jul 10, 2020 · Continue to wash tie dye shirts alone, or with other tie dye items or similarly colored garments. Turn tie dye garments inside out before placing them in the washing machine. Use a high quality laundry detergent. Run the washer on the gentle cycle using cold water.
